2010-06-13 9 views
0

압축 된 음성 + 화면 스트림이 포함 된 사용자 지정 ASF 파일을 만들었습니다.ASF 지속 시간은 29 초, WMP는 25 초 재생됩니다. 어째서?

헤더에 따른 파일의 총 지속 기간은 29 초입니다.

WMP에서 (사용자 지정 DMO를 사용하여 스트림을 재생할 때) 파일을 열면 25 초가 지나고 탐색 모음이 시작 부분으로 이동하지만 이상하게도 WMP는 중지하기 전에 4 초 더 계속 재생합니다.

ASF 뷰어로 ASF를 살펴보면 29 초가 걸리고 "재생 시간"과 "재생 시간"은 모두 29 초입니다. 왜 WMP는 단지 25 초 만 볼까요 ??

감사

+0

BTW - 프리 롤은 3 초이며 3 초 미만의 프리 롤을 사용할 수 없기 때문에이 이유가 왜 발생하는지 알 수 없습니다. – Roey

답변

0

내 생각은 패킷이 재생되기 전에 WMP 진행 표시 줄 대신에 이후의 업데이트되고 있다는 점이다.

+0

그 이유는 무엇입니까? 그것에 대해 무엇을 할 수 있습니까? – Roey

+0

고급 시스템 형식 파일을 검사하여 형식이 올바른지 확인하십시오. 형식이 맞으면 Windows Media Player의 문제점을 Microsoft에보고하십시오. –

+0

Microsoft에서 승인 한 MPEG-4 압축을 사용하고 있습니까? –

0

ASF 인덱스가 손상되었을 때 (예 : 25 초의 인덱스 항목이 첫 번째 데이터 패킷을 가리키는 경우)이 동작을 보았습니다.